The Rules Of Packaging Design That Make Your Product Standout

  • By Walter Baker
  • Mar-20-2016
  • Brands, Business
  • Comments Off on The Rules Of Packaging Design That Make Your Product Standout

March 20, 2016 – As soon as you enter the world of business, you’d be faced with the challenge of competing with many other companies that offer the same products and services that you do and you would have to do all it takes to standout. There are many ways to do this. Utilizing effective marketing strategies can do wonders for your business. However, marketing is only one of the important factors that you should give focus to. If there is one thing that is as important as or more important than marketing, it would have to be your product because that is what you will use to gain profit.

According to the Food Marketing Institute, the average US supermarket has about 40,000 items in their shelves. If your product would be placed in supermarkets, you are basically just one fish in the reef. Your product is considered as the face of your company but how will you be able to make your face standout? Why, through product packaging of course! You should give enough thought and consideration as well as integrate marketing elements into your product’s packaging design. Here are the rules of product packaging that would make your product standout.

  1. Honesty is the best policy. Companies who are new to the business game would want to present their products in the most perfect way possible. However, this often leads to the product’s packaging depicting an exaggerated version of the product inside which could mislead the customers. Consumers would want to see honest and inexpensive products so you should think about when designing.
  2. Simplicity is beauty. Your product’s packaging should be able to tell the customers two important things: what the product is for, and what is the brand behind it? Most products fail to provide this information to customers when that is actually all they’re looking for.
  3. Originality is a byproduct of sincerity. With so many competing items, you would need originality to standout. Try to make your product look different from the others. Analyze your competition as there are always similarities between products and stray from that.
